Former PM Manmohan Singh hails PV for introducing reforms

Hyderabad: Former Prime Minister Manmohan Singh on Monday said former Prime Minister late PV Narasimha Rao stressed that reforms will have to take into account Indian concerns and would have to protect the interests of the poor and working people.
During his tenure, several decisions were taken both with respect to the economic and foreign policies, Manmohan Singh said, addressing a virtual PV Narasimha Rao centenary celebrations organized by TPCC here. “He was a rare scholar and statesman who gave a new sense of direction to India’s economic and also our foreign policies,” he said.
Under his leadership, India launched the Ballistic Missile Technology Programme, he said, adding that the Augmented Satellite Launch Vehicle (ASLV) and Polar Satellite Launch Vehicle (PSLV) were successfully tested. “We also tested our Prithvi Missile, which was subsequently developed into an intermediate range ballistic missile,” the former Prime Minister said.
Meanwhile, outgoing TPCC president N Uttam Kumar Reddy said: “All the party workers are working hard to strengthening the party and their hard work should be recognized by giving them suitable opportunities.” He, however, refrained from commenting on Bhongir MP Komatireddy Venkat Reddy’s comments on the party affairs.
The newly appointed TPCC chief A. Revanth Reddy called on former MP V Hanumantha Rao, who is undergoing treatment for kidney ailment at a private hospital. He also met former Ministers Chenna Reddy and Ponnala Laxmaiah.
